problem with downloaded objectdock background?

i've downloaded some bg from wincustomize, unzipped them into OD folder, but i cant use them!
when i opened OD settings, the downloaded themes do not appear, they're just blank like this:screenie,  Image Hosting

I have a number of blank space like that too, but I don't thing that's related to the problem.

I installed some backgrounds which went to  %username% > Documents > Stardock > Object Dock Library > Backgrounds. All I did was move them to C:\ Program Files > Stardock > Object Dock > Backgrounds > non tabbed, and they appeared  OK.

It could be to do with files not installing in the same place they used to.

If you place them in C:\ Program Files > Stardock > Object Dock > Backgrounds it won't matter about the tabbed/non-tabbed. Depending on the backgrounds you downloaded, some of mine for instance, you won't see the preview in your config screen like you posted but you would see the names.

Try moving them to the folder I listed (make sure they are in their own folder inside that Backgrounds folder). Close the OD config screen and then re-open it, they should show up.
